Chapter 11

Martha slowly walked up the beach; her flip-flops in hand, letting the sand slip through her toes. Looking out to sea, she really couldn’t see a point to her life anymore. Chris was getting worse, she had pushed Jack away, and her situation wasn’t any better than it had been a year ago. She sighed as the wind blew her hair around her face. As she continued to walk she found herself in a secluded spot, on a cliff. She had never been up there before, which wasn’t really surprising considering that she was scared of heights, but now that she was there, the place was giving her some sort of peace of mind. She sat down, trying to avoid the bad thoughts that occupied her brain most of the time.

Martha had been sitting at the same spot for an hour when she heard footsteps behind her. She got up and spun around quickly. Her face registered surprise.

“Jack.” She said quietly, refusing to look at him. Jack stayed silent for while before finally replying.

“You know, only you can get yourself out of the situation your in.” he said. Martha looked up.

“No one can get me out of the situation I’m in.” she replied honestly.

“Come on Martha! Of course you can get out of the situation! All you’ve got to do is leave him, it’s really quite simple, but you’re not letting yourself do it!” he replied in an annoyed tone. Martha stared at him, surprised by the fact that he seemed irritated. Inside, her anger was slowly rising too.

“You don’t know anything about my situation!” she said loudly. “Don’t you think that if I could get out of it I would?! God, what do you take me for?? I’m not stupid you know! So don’t you dare judge me, don’t you dare get annoyed with me because it’s the last thing I need right now!” she finished yelling and started to cry, looking quickly away from Jack. Jack felt awful, seeing her there crying, knowing that it was all because he had lost his temper.

“Martha I’m sorry…” he said, opening his arms to hug her, but Martha pushed his arms away.

“Don’t touch me!” she yelled “I needed your support not your judgement! Just don’t speak to me.” She finished and walked away, leaving Jack feeling worse than ever.

Jack entered his house after a long walk to find Robbie and Tasha there, waiting for him.

“Hey guys.” He said subdued. “What are you here for?”

“Well...” started Tasha.

“We were going to ask you if you wanted to come to the diner with us for lunch.” continued Robbie.

“But…by the looks of things, we need to talk, because no offence but you look terrible.” finished Tasha, smiling sympathetically at Jack. She pointed to the seat opposite where they were sitting on the couch, indicating for him to sit down.

“Come on.” said Tasha. “Spill.”
